
Nucleosídeos
Os nucleosídeos são building blocks fundamentais dos ácidos nucleicos, compostos por uma base nitrogenada ligada a uma molécula de açúcar. Nesta seção, você encontrará uma ampla variedade de nucleosídeos essenciais para pesquisas em biologia molecular, bioquímica e farmacologia. Esses compostos desempenham papéis cruciais na síntese de DNA e RNA, e também são vitais em vários processos metabólicos. Os nucleosídeos são usados para estudar material genético, desenvolver terapias antivirais e anticancerígenas, e entender os mecanismos celulares.
